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27227 92308 364804 399 82
6903668 4682432801 5872902884
6903668 4682432801 5872902884
4111 491514937 8761177
All about undefined
Interested in learning more?
6903668 4682432801 5872902884
4111 491514937 8761177
See more
6949320 8857
3366 53539060398 2428 7473176 14053
See more
474866 12949802872
218884383 4701749 4204 54
See more